如何自己搭建VPN服务器? 自己怎么搭建vpn服务器

在当今的信息时代 , 保护自己的网络隐私已经成为了一件非常重要的事情 。然而,如果你每次需要在不安全的网络环境下进行连接时,都选择使用公共WiFi,那么你的网络隐私就极有可能会被泄露 。为了更好地保护自己的网络隐私,我们可以搭建一个VPN服务器来达到加密通信的目的 。本文将会介绍如何搭建一个简单的VPN服务器,来实现网络隐私保护 。
1. 环境准备
在开始搭建VPN服务器之前 , 首先需要做好一些准备工作 。我们需要一台VPS(Virtual Private Server)或者是一个家用服务器,并且服务器的运行系统需要是Ubuntu或者是Debian , 同时需要确保服务器拥有足够的带宽和存储空间 。
2. 安装PPtP-VPN服务端
我们需要通过在终端中输入命令行,进行PPtP-VPN服务端的安装 。具体的命令如下:
$ sudo apt-get update
$ sudo apt-get install pptpd
安装完成后 , 我们需要对一些配置文件进行修改 。首先 , 我们需要编辑/etc/pptpd.conf文件,将其中的localip和remoteip两个项进行配置 。
$ sudo nano /etc/pptpd.conf
其中,localip是指VPN服务器的IP地址,而remoteip则是指在连接VPN时,为客户端分配的IP地址范围 。
3. 添加VPN客户端用户
接下来 , 我们需要添加VPN客户端用户 。我们可以通过编辑/etc/ppp/chap-secrets文件,来添加一个新的VPN客户端的用户名和密码:
$ sudo nano /etc/ppp/chap-secrets
格式如下:
[username] pptpd [password] *
4. 修改网络配置
为了让VPN客户端能够访问到互联网上的资源,我们需要对网络配置进行一些修改,以此来实现数据转发的功能 。
$ sudo nano /etc/sysctl.conf
在该文件中,我们需要将net.ipv4.ip_forward的值改为1,保存并退出 。接着,我们需要在终端中输入以下命令,激活刚刚修改的系统内核参数:
$ sudo sysctl -p
5. 启动VPN服务
最后,我们需要启动VPN服务 。我们可以通过在终端中输入以下命令来启动VPN服务:
$ sudo service pptpd start
6. 测试VPN连接
当VPN服务启动之后,我们就可以通过设置PPtP-VPN客户端来进行连接了 。在连接VPN之前,我们需要确保网络环境是非常安全的,并且需要确保自己的身份信息是准确的 。连接成功后,我们可以尝试一些网络访问测试 , 以此来确保VPN服务已经正常工作 。
【如何自己搭建VPN服务器? 自己怎么搭建vpn服务器】本文阐述了如何搭建一个简单的VPN服务器 , 以此来实现网络数据的加密传输和隐私保护 。需要注意的是,在搭建VPN服务器之前,我们需要确保环境准备工作做好,并且需要做好一些安全方面的准备工作 。在VPN服务启动之后,我们可以通过设置PPtP-VPN客户端来进行连接,并测试网络访问功能 。希望本文的介绍对大家有所帮助 。

    推荐阅读